Harz BaudenSteig

Enjoy the sunny side of the Harz

The Harzer BaudenSteig connects the most beautiful forest inns and mountain lodges (Bauden) on the sunny side of the Harz Mountains and offers a hiking experience with wonderful places to stop for a bite to eat.

Marked with the brown symbol, it leads hikers on 6 stages for about 100 km from Bad Grund to Walkenried Monastery. The Bauden range from rustic to refined and offer Harz hospitality and tasty specialities. In addition to the Bauden, varied and well-signposted trails, magnificent views, as well as numerous attractions along the route make this hike an unforgettable experience.

Tip: For hikers who don't want to walk an entire stage, circular trails are marked along the Harzer BaudenSteig. These give you the opportunity to reach the Bauden on half-day or full-day hikes. Without walking the same path twice, you can easily return to your starting point at the car park.
